e514965f7e [lit] Use process pools for test execution by default
Summary:
This drastically reduces lit test execution startup time on Windows. Our
previous strategy was to manually create one Process per job and manage
the worker pool ourselves. Instead, let's use the worker pool provided
by multiprocessing.  multiprocessing.Pool(jobs) returns almost
immediately, and initializes the appropriate number of workers, so they
can all start executing tests immediately. This avoids the ramp-up
period that the old implementation suffers from.  This appears to speed
up small test runs.

Here are some timings of the llvm-readobj tests on Windows using the
various execution strategies:

 # multiprocessing.Pool:
$ for i in `seq 1 3`; do tim python ./bin/llvm-lit.py -sv ../llvm/test/tools/llvm-readobj/ --use-process-pool |& grep real: ; done
real: 0m1.156s
real: 0m1.078s
real: 0m1.094s

 # multiprocessing.Process:
$ for i in `seq 1 3`; do tim python ./bin/llvm-lit.py -sv ../llvm/test/tools/llvm-readobj/ --use-processes |& grep real: ; done
real: 0m6.062s
real: 0m5.860s
real: 0m5.984s

 # threading.Thread:
$ for i in `seq 1 3`; do tim python ./bin/llvm-lit.py -sv ../llvm/test/tools/llvm-readobj/ --use-threads |& grep real: ; done
real: 0m9.438s
real: 0m10.765s
real: 0m11.079s

I kept the old code to launch processes in case this change doesn't work
on all platforms that LLVM supports, but at some point I would like to
remove both the threading and old multiprocessing execution strategies.

4a035b600a [DAGCombiner] Don't make a BUILD_VECTOR with operands of illegal type.
When DAGCombiner visits a SIGN_EXTEND_INREG of a BUILD_VECTOR with
constant operands, a new BUILD_VECTOR node will be created transformed
constants.

Llvm-stress found a case where the new BUILD_VECTOR had constant operands
of an illegal type, because the (legal) element type is in fact not a legal
scalar type.

This patch changes this so that the new BUILD_VECTOR has the same operand
type as the old one.

ff1254b6f8 Add MCContext argument to MCAsmBackend::applyFixup for error reporting
A number of backends (AArch64, MIPS, ARM) have been using
MCContext::reportError to report issues such as out-of-range fixup values in
their TgtAsmBackend. This is great, but because MCContext couldn't easily be
threaded through to the adjustFixupValue helper function from its usual
callsite (applyFixup), these backends ended up adding an MCContext* argument
and adding another call to applyFixup to processFixupValue. Adding an
MCContext parameter to applyFixup makes this unnecessary, and even better -
applyFixup can take a reference to MCContext rather than a potentially null
pointer.

3a168569fc [LAA] Correctly return a half-open range in expandBounds
This is a latent bug that's been hanging around for a while. For a loop-invariant
pointer, expandBounds would return the range {Ptr, Ptr}, but this was interpreted
as a half-open range, not a closed range. So we ended up planting incorrect
bounds checks. Even worse, they were tautological, so we ended up incorrectly
executing the optimized loop.

e339e10540 [X86] Relax assert in broadcast-of-subvector lowering.
Before r294774, there was a problem when lowering broadcasts to use
128-bit subvectors.

When we looked through a bitcast to find the broadcast input, we'd keep
using the original type, so you'd end up with things like:
  (v8f32 (broadcast
    (v4f32 (extract_subvector
      (v8i32 V),
      ...))
    ))

r294774 fixed it to always emit subvectors with the scalar type of the
original source.

It also introduced some asserts, to check that we use scalars with
the same size, and vectors with the same number of elements.

The scalar size equality is checked earlier when looking through bitcasts,
and is a useful assert.

However, the number of elements don't have to be identical: we're always
going to extract a 128-bit subvector, and we can have different size
inputs if we looked through a concat_vector to find a 256-bit source.

Relax the overzealous assert.

Replace it with a check of the original source vector being 256 or 512
bits.  If it's 128 bits, we can't extract_subvector from it.

Fixes PR32371.

4dd33e6269 Implement host CPU detection for AArch64
This shares detection logic with ARM(32), since AArch64 capable CPUs may
also run in 32-bit system mode.

We observe weird /proc/cpuinfo output for MSM8992 and MSM8994, where
they report all CPU cores as one single model, depending on which CPU
core the kernel is running on. As a workaround, we hardcode the known
CPU part name for these SoCs.

For big.LITTLE systems, this patch would only return the part name of
the first core (usually the little core). Proper support will be added
in a follow-up change.

e65aa1c44e [RuntimeDyld] Make RuntimeDyld honor the ProcessAllSections flag.
When the ProcessAllSections flag (introduced in r204398) is set RuntimeDyld is
supposed to make a call to the client's memory manager for every section in each
object that is loaded. Due to some missing checks, this was not happening in all
cases. This patch adds the missing cases, and fixes the Orc unit test that
verifies correct behavior for ProcessAllSections (The unit test had been
silently bailing out due to an ordering issue: a change in the test order meant
that this unit-test was running before the native target was registered. This
issue has also been fixed in this patch).
